Streamlining Operations
The path to maximizing profit margins often weaves through the underappreciated territory of streamlining operations. At first, managing suppliers, equipment, and production schedules felt like an uphill battle. However, after taking a step back to evaluate my processes, I discovered several areas ripe for improvement. By simplifying production workflows, I not only boosted efficiency but also realized considerable cost savings.
Implementing inventory management software can be transformative. When you know exactly when to reorder ingredients and materials, you can avoid both overstock issues and the headaches of running out of essential items. This level of foresight enables your brewery to operate smoothly, significantly reducing waste that could otherwise hurt your bottom line.

Innovating with Sustainability
Finally, embracing sustainable practices isn’t just a passing trend; it’s a crucial strategy for modern breweries looking to maximize profit margins. From sourcing local ingredients to adopting eco-friendly packaging solutions, there are numerous ways to weave sustainability into your operations.
Beyond appealing to eco-conscious consumers, implementing such practices can lead to cost-saving benefits in the long run. For instance, repurposing spent grains into new products or forming partnerships with local farms can create a positive feedback loop that benefits both your brewery and the environment. Moreover, showcasing your commitment to sustainability resonates deeply with customers, adding an emotional dimension to your brand that fosters loyalty.
